一、强大的技术架构是基础
天翼云 CDN 拥有分布式的架构设计。这种架构把整个系统分成多个子系统,每个子系统都能处理一部分请求。当大量请求涌来时,不会集中在某一个核心节点,而是分散到各个子系统进行处理。就像把一堆任务分给很多人同时做,效率自然就提高了。
在服务器方面,天翼云 CDN 采用了高性能的硬件设备。这些服务器具有强大的计算能力和存储能力,能够快速处理用户的请求,同时存储大量的静态资源,比如网页图片、脚本文件等。当用户请求这些资源时,服务器可以迅速响应,减少延迟。
二、广泛的节点布局是关键
节点就像是分布在各地的中转站。天翼云 CDN 在全境范围内部署了大量的边缘节点。这些节点分布在不同的地区、不同的网络运营商中。当用户发起请求时,系统会自动选择离用户最近的节点来处理请求。这样做有两个好处:一是减少了数据传输的距离,降低了延迟;二是分散了中心节点的压力,让各个边缘节点分担流量。
举个例子,一个北京的用户访问一个金融网络,系统会让北京的边缘节点来处理这个请求,而不是让请求跑到很远的中心服务器再回来。这样用户就能更快地获取到所需的内容,同时也减轻了中心节点的负担,让整个系统能够处理更多的请求。
三、智能的调度系统是核心
为了让请求能够准确、高效地分配到合适的节点,天翼云 CDN 开发了智能调度系统。这个系统会实时收集各个节点的负荷情况、网络状态等信息。然后根据这些信息,运用先进的算法来判断哪个节点最适合处理当前的请求。
比如,当某个节点的负荷过高时,调度系统会自动减少分配到该节点的请求,把更多的请求分配到负荷较低的节点。这样就能保证各个节点的负荷均衡,防止出现某些节点忙不过来,而某些节点却闲置的情况。同时,调度系统还能根据用户的网络类型、地理位置等因素,为用户选择最优的节点,进一步提高用户的访问速度。
四、高效的缓存策略是助力
在互联网中,很多用户请求的内容是重复的,比如一些常用的网页、图片、视频等。如果每次都从源服务器获取这些内容,不仅会增加源服务器的压力,还会导致用户访问速度变慢。天翼云 CDN 采用了高效的缓存策略,把这些常用的内容缓存到边缘节点上。
当用户第一次请求某个内容时,边缘节点会从源服务器获取该内容并缓存起来。当其他用户再次请求相同的内容时,边缘节点就可以直接从缓存中获取并返回给用户,不需要再去源服务器获取。这样不仅提高了响应速度,还减少了源服务器的流量消耗,让源服务器能够处理更多的动态请求。
为了保证缓存的有效性,天翼云 CDN 还会根据内容的更新频率、访问热度等因素,动态调整缓存策略。对于更新频繁的内容,会缩短缓存时间,及时从源服务器获取最新的内容;对于访问热度高的内容,会优先缓存,提高缓存命中率。
五、完善的安全防护是保障
在应对流量洪峰的过程中,安全问题不容忽视。金融行业的数据涉及用户的资金、隐私等重要信息,一旦受到攻击,后果不堪设想。天翼云 CDN 具备完善的安全防护体系,能够有效抵御各种网络攻击。
首先,它采用了 DDoS 攻击防护技术。DDoS 攻击是通过大量的虚假请求来占用网络带宽和服务器资源,导致正常用户的请求无法得到处理。天翼云 CDN 的 DDoS 防护系统能够实时检测到这些攻击流量,并将其清洗掉,保证正常流量的畅通。
其次,对于应用层的攻击,比如 SQL 注入、XSS 攻击等,天翼云 CDN 也有相应的防护措施。它通过部署 Web 应用防火墙(WAF),对用户的请求进行实时监控和过滤,阻止恶意请求到达源服务器。
六、实战案例见证实力
在一次某大型金融机构的促销活动中,预计会出现大量的用户访问。活动开始后,流量瞬间飙升,达到了每秒 25 万次的请求峰值。在这种情况下,天翼云 CDN 凭借其强大的技术架构、广泛的节点布局、智能的调度系统、高效的缓存策略和完善的安全防护体系,成功应对了这次流量洪峰。
用户在访问该金融机构的网络和 APP 时,没有出现卡顿、延迟等问题,交易过程顺利进行。这次实战不仅验证了天翼云 CDN 的强大性能,也为金融行业应对类似的流量挑战提供了宝贵的经验。
总结
面对金融级的流量洪峰,天翼云 CDN 通过强大的技术架构、广泛的节点布局、智能的调度系统、高效的缓存策略和完善的安全防护体系,形成了一套完整的解决方案。这些技术和策略相互配合,共同保障了系统在高并发情况下的稳定运行,为金融行业的数字化转型提供了坚实的支撑。
随着互联网技术的不断发展,金融行业对流量处理和系统稳定性的要求会越来越高。天翼云 CDN 也将不断创新和优化,为用户提供更加高效、可靠的服务,助力金融行业在数字化时代取得更好的发展。